Translation of Spanish word "joven" to English
joven
/ˈxoβen/
How to use
Joven ('young person / youth') is masculine or feminine depending on the person: el joven (young man), la joven (young woman). Plural: jóvenes (note the accent mark).
🇬🇧 English
young person
Example
El joven es muy inteligente.
The young man is very smart.
Ella es una joven estudiante.
She is a young student.
